Project Overview
The Busan Park Landscape Tensile Membrane Project is located in Jiangmen City, Jianghai District, China. Completed in September 2020, this 150 m² recreational area features a soft-edge tensile membrane structure with perimeter steel cables. The canopy measures approximately 15 m × 10 m with a height of 8 m, and the steel structure uses around 1.5 tons of steel.
The steel frame is treated with an epoxy-rich zinc primer and white topcoat for corrosion resistance and durability. The roof is covered with 1100 g/㎡ white PVDF membrane, achieving B1 fire rating and meeting public safety standards.

Installation - Support
Installation was completed by our professional engineering team. Due to site restrictions, aerial work platforms were used instead of large cranes. Special attention was given to the alignment of soft-edge cables and PVC membrane to ensure smooth, even tension, leveraging our team’s extensive experience.
